In keeping with today's technological advances the TG variable gradient kilns add another dimension to ceramic trial firing. These kilns allow each chamber to be programmed to different top temperatures whilst maintaining the pre-programmed firing curve giving total flexibility and outstanding results.

Specifically designed for frit trial firing, the TG6 Mk III is available in two maximum design temperatures, 1300ºC and 1400ºC. Both kilns incorporate the following features essential for frit trials.
- 6 individual chambers
- Individual thermocouple and relay to each chamber
- Programmable flexible gradient between individual chambers
- Spiral wound kanthal elements
- TCM2 microprocessor controller managing the firing process
- Thermocouple automatically lowered into crucible containing sample frit on closure of the door
